Abstract

Introduction: Cutaneous T-cell lymphoma (CTCL) is a rare malignancy with mycosis fungoides (MF) being the most common subtype. Classic MF typically presents with patches that may progress over years into plaques and tumors. In rare instances, the tumor d'emblee variant can be found, with initial appearance of tumors without prior patches or plaques. Case: A 37-year-old male presented with a one-month history of multiple cutaneous nodules involving the face, scalp and trunk, accompanied by a five-month history of progressive left testicular enlargement. There was a history of weight loss and severe anemia. Physical examination revealed multiple firm, grouped tumors with smooth surfaces, brownish to violaceous in color, distributed across the scalp, face, back, neck, thorax, abdomen, and bilateral upper extremities. Laboratory findings included pancytopenia, electrolyte imbalance, hypoalbuminemia, and elevated urea and creatinine. Histopathological examination showed diffuse infiltrates of large atypical lymphoid cells with atypical mitoses from superficial to deep dermis. The patient deteriorated rapidly during hospitalization and died three days after diagnosis was established. Conclusion: Tumor d'emblee is a rare and aggressive MF variant with a lower survival rate than the classic MF. It is crucial to establish a diagnosis based on clinical appearance, histopathological examination and immunohistochemistry.
